How to choose the right provider in Terang
- Check their service mix: Many Terang plan managers also offer other supports. Consider if you want a provider that can bundle services or if you prefer a specialist focused solely on finances.
- Ask about their local knowledge: A provider familiar with Terang and the wider Corangamite Shire may have better insights into local support options and unregistered providers you can access.
- Clarify their communication style: Do they offer regular statements? Can you easily reach someone by phone or email? This is crucial for peace of mind, especially in regional areas.
- Consider your need for proximity: While much plan management can be done remotely, some participants value having occasional face-to-face meetings. Determine if having a local office is important for you.

How a Plan Manager helps Terang participants
A Plan Manager takes on the financial administration of your NDIS plan. They pay your support providers directly from your NDIS funds, track your budgets across different categories, and provide regular statements so you can see exactly how your funding is being used. This removes a significant administrative burden, giving you more time and energy to focus on achieving your goals.
Importantly, using a Plan Manager increases your choice and control. You are not limited to only NDIS-registered providers; you can also engage unregistered providers, which can be especially valuable for finding specialised local support in Terang. Are all Plan Managers in Terang registered with the NDIS?
To handle your NDIS funds directly, a Plan Manager must be registered with the NDIS Commission. In Terang, there are currently 20 registered Plan Managers operating, ensuring they meet the required quality and safeguarding standards.
